Job summary
The University of North Carolina seeks an Elder Law Adjunct Instructor for its online Gerontology program. This temporary position requires an experienced professional to teach the Elder Law for Gerontological Professionals course, emphasizing online interaction and effective student engagement. Applicants should possess a terminal degree or a significant elder law background and demonstrate strong communication and interpersonal skills.
Qualifications
Must meet SACSCOC guidelines with a terminal degree or significant work experience.
Preferably an elder law attorney with experience in elder law practice.
Responsibilities
Instruct and guide the class in an efficient and effective manner.
Maintain accurate records of student work and attendance.
Grade and return student work in a timely manner.
Skills
Interpersonal skills
Communication skills
Knowledge of online pedagogy
Teaching online students
Education
Terminal degree in field of instruction
Graduate degree and significant work experience in elder law
